| The starting lineup is being assembled for the food that will be offered at Citi Field, the Mets’ new stadium, which is scheduled to open next spring. The management of the Mets and Aramark, the Philadelphia food service company that is in charge of food in the stadium, have confirmed that Danny Meyer’s Union Square Hospitality Group will open a Blue Smoke barbecue restaurant; a Shake Shack stand; Pop Fries, serving Belgian-style hand-cut fries; and a taqueria. | Aramark bought the Harry M. Stevens Co. about 10-15 years ago. The association with Aramark only continues a link that's been in place in New York City -- Polo Grounds, Ebbetts Field, Shea, the Garden, Meadowlands, all the racetracks -- for 100-plus years.
